Ex-official in Argentina found guilty of death of journalist in 1976

An ex-police officer and ex-deputy in Argentina has been found guilty of killing a journalist 35 years ago, reported the Associated Press on Nov. 25. Judge Adrián González found Luis Abelardo Patti guilty of the kidnapping, torture and killing of Ricardo Giménez in January, 1976, two months before the military coup d"état that ushered in Argentina"s last dictatorship.

Giménez was a reporter for the newspaper El Actual in Escobar, Buenos Aires. The journalist was on a list of disappeared for several decades until his remains were identified on Feb. 21, 2008, according to the Télam news agency. Patti will serve a life sentence for crimes against humanity. He has been jailed since April, 2011, reported La Nación. This is the first time a civil servant that has held elected office since 1983 has been found guilty of crimes against humanity, the newspaper reported.
